Understanding the Sola Salons Business Model
Before diving into the numbers, it's important to understand how Sola Salons generates revenue. Here’s a summary of how our salon franchise owners make money:
- Each location consists of 35-50 private salon suites
- These suites are leased to independent beauty professionals
- Beauty professionals pay a weekly rent for their suite space
- Franchisees collect this rent as their primary source of revenue

What Revenue Means for Franchisees
For Sola Salons franchisees, revenue directly translates into business success. Here's how:
- Predictable Cash Flow: The weekly rental model provides a steady, predictable income stream.
- Scalability: As you increase occupancy rates, your revenue grows without a proportional increase in expenses.
- Low Overhead: The B2B nature of the business model means lower operational costs compared to traditional retail or service businesses.
- Growth Potential: Successful single-unit operators often expand to multi-unit ownership, multiplying their earning potential.
